In this episode of TruthWorks, Jessica and Patty sit down with Cem Kansu, the Chief Product Officer at Duolingo. Cem has spent nearly a decade architecting the product strategy that grew Duolingo from a struggling startup into the world’s #1 education app.
This isn’t just a conversation about "product-market fit." It’s a raw look at the operational culture required to run thousands of A/B tests a year without losing your soul. Cem pulls back the curtain on Duolingo’s famous "unhinged" marketing, the reality of managing a "freemium" model that actually makes money, and why they decided to make their AI mascot, Lily, a depressed teenager.
Key topics discussed include:
- The "Mini-CEO" Mindset: Why Duolingo empowers product managers to run their own P&Ls and how that changes the culture of accountability.
- Monetization vs. Mission: The hard conversations and trade-offs involved in making money while keeping the core product free for millions.
- The Truth About Gamification: How to use streaks, leaderboards, and "passive-aggressive" notifications to drive retention without burning out your team (or your users).
- Hiring for Taste: Why data is critical, but product intuition is what actually builds a brand people love.
- Navigating the AI Shift: How Duolingo is integrating GenAI to teach effectively, not just efficiently.
Whether you are scaling a product team or trying to build a culture that embraces experimentation, Cem offers a transparent look at the machinery behind the owl.
